Wickmayer to get ASB Classic started

6:33 am on 4 January 2010

Third seed, Belgium's Yanina Wickmayer, will open proceedings on centre court, when the ASB Tennis Classic starts later this morning in Auckland.

The women's world number 16 will face Julia Goerges of Germany, followed by top seed Flavia Pennetta of Italy who will take on American veteran Jill Craybas.

Meanwhile local hope Marine Erakovic is set for a tough workout later in the day with her Slovakian doubles partner Polona Hercog.

The wildcard pairing will confront top seeds, Cara Black and Liezel Huber.
